Concrete Spalling Repair in Miami Dade County, FL

Concrete spalling repair services address the issue of surface flaking, chipping, or peeling on concrete surfaces such as driveways, sidewalks, patios, and foundations. This damage often results from exposure to moisture, freeze-thaw cycles, or poor initial installation, leading to weakened concrete and potential safety hazards. Repairing spalling helps restore the structural integrity and appearance of concrete surfaces, preventing further deterioration and extending their lifespan. Property owners typically request this service when noticing cracks, crumbling patches, or unsightly surface damage that affects the functionality or curb appeal of their property.

Before requesting concrete spalling repair, property owners should understand the extent of the damage and whether it is confined to the surface or indicates deeper structural issues. It’s important to evaluate how widespread the spalling is and whether it affects critical areas like foundations or load-bearing surfaces. Additionally, understanding the underlying causes, such as moisture infiltration or temperature fluctuations, can help determine the most appropriate repair method. Proper assessment ensures that repairs address both the cosmetic and structural concerns, providing a durable solution for maintaining the safety and value of the property.

Concrete Spalling Repair Questions

What causes concrete spalling? Spalling often results from freeze-thaw cycles, moisture infiltration, or poor concrete quality, leading to surface deterioration.

How can spalling affect a property? Spalling can weaken concrete surfaces, create safety hazards, and reduce the aesthetic appeal of driveways, patios, or other structures.

Is spalling repair necessary? Repairing spalling helps restore the integrity of concrete surfaces and prevents further damage or deterioration.

What types of projects typically need spalling repair? Common projects include driveways, sidewalks, pool decks, and building facades experiencing surface chipping or cracking.
